python中的多变量,如PHP中的$$ var

时间:2014-02-23 20:19:16

标签: php python

在PHP中如下

<?php

$a = 'b'
$b = 'c'

echo $$a

?>

输出:c

在Python中是否有类似的实现,如$$ ..?

1 个答案:

答案 0 :(得分:1)

不....不是真的可以做像

这样的事情
a = 'b'
b = 'c'

globals().getattr(a,None)

甚至更好使用词典(你应该真的这样做!!!)

env = {'a':5,'b':'a'}
env[env['b']]

但没有像$$a

那样的内容